PM lauds Pakistan Navy’s operation to seize 1.3 tons of narcotics

Advertisement

ISLAMABAD: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if lauded the Pakistan Navy for successfully carrying out an operation in the North Arabian Sea in which 1.3 tons of narcotics were seized.

The prime minister, in a statement, said that the vibrant leadership of the Pakistan Navy led to the seizure of huge quantity of narcotics in the operation.

He said that foiling the attempt to smuggle a huge quantity of narcotics was laudable.

“The whole nation feels proud of the officials of the Pakistan Navy. The elimination of narcotics was essential for the welfare of humanity,” he remarked.

Prime Minister Shehbaz reiterated that the government was determined to extend all possible facilities to the Pakistan Navy in its mission to purge country of narcotics.

Earlier,  Federal Government has decided to send humanitarian aid which will include blankets, medicines and warm clothes to Gaza on the arrival of winter.

A meeting was held on the situation in Gaza under the chairmanship of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if, in which a briefing was given by National Disaster Management Authority (NDMA).

It was decided in the meeting that the federal government will send humanitarian aid to Gaza on the arrival of winter and it has been decided to immediately send 600 tons of aid to Gaza, which will include blankets, medicines and warm clothes.
